Loading packages/SystemUI/src/com/android/systemui/statusbar/phone/CollapsedStatusBarFragment.java +17 −2 Original line number Diff line number Diff line Loading @@ -56,6 +56,11 @@ import android.os.Handler; import android.app.ActivityManager; import static lineageos.providers.LineageSettings.System.HIDE_NOTIFICATIONICON_LEFT_SYSTEM_ICON; import android.view.Gravity; import android.widget.FrameLayout; /** * Contains the collapsed status bar and handles hiding/showing based on disable flags * and keyguard state. Also manages lifecycle to make sure the views it contains are being Loading Loading @@ -217,13 +222,23 @@ public class CollapsedStatusBarFragment extends Fragment implements CommandQueue if(null==notificationIconArea){ notificationIconArea = mStatusBar.findViewById(R.id.notification_icon_area); } FrameLayout.LayoutParams params = new FrameLayout.LayoutParams(FrameLayout.LayoutParams.MATCH_PARENT, FrameLayout.LayoutParams.MATCH_PARENT); if(ishide_notificationIcon==1){ notificationIconArea.setVisibility(View.GONE); mSystemIconArea.setVisibility(View.GONE); // mSystemIconArea.setVisibility(View.GONE); params.gravity = Gravity.CENTER_VERTICAL|Gravity.START; mSystemIconArea.setLayoutParams(params); }else { notificationIconArea.setVisibility(View.VISIBLE); mSystemIconArea.setVisibility(View.VISIBLE); //mSystemIconArea.setVisibility(View.VISIBLE); params.gravity = Gravity.CENTER_VERTICAL|Gravity.END; mSystemIconArea.setLayoutParams(params); } } Loading Loading
packages/SystemUI/src/com/android/systemui/statusbar/phone/CollapsedStatusBarFragment.java +17 −2 Original line number Diff line number Diff line Loading @@ -56,6 +56,11 @@ import android.os.Handler; import android.app.ActivityManager; import static lineageos.providers.LineageSettings.System.HIDE_NOTIFICATIONICON_LEFT_SYSTEM_ICON; import android.view.Gravity; import android.widget.FrameLayout; /** * Contains the collapsed status bar and handles hiding/showing based on disable flags * and keyguard state. Also manages lifecycle to make sure the views it contains are being Loading Loading @@ -217,13 +222,23 @@ public class CollapsedStatusBarFragment extends Fragment implements CommandQueue if(null==notificationIconArea){ notificationIconArea = mStatusBar.findViewById(R.id.notification_icon_area); } FrameLayout.LayoutParams params = new FrameLayout.LayoutParams(FrameLayout.LayoutParams.MATCH_PARENT, FrameLayout.LayoutParams.MATCH_PARENT); if(ishide_notificationIcon==1){ notificationIconArea.setVisibility(View.GONE); mSystemIconArea.setVisibility(View.GONE); // mSystemIconArea.setVisibility(View.GONE); params.gravity = Gravity.CENTER_VERTICAL|Gravity.START; mSystemIconArea.setLayoutParams(params); }else { notificationIconArea.setVisibility(View.VISIBLE); mSystemIconArea.setVisibility(View.VISIBLE); //mSystemIconArea.setVisibility(View.VISIBLE); params.gravity = Gravity.CENTER_VERTICAL|Gravity.END; mSystemIconArea.setLayoutParams(params); } } Loading